WebMonet’s painting, The Gare Saint-Lazare, overwhelms the viewer not though its scale (a modest 29 ½ by 41 inches), but through the deep sea of steam and smoke that envelops the canvas. Indeed, as one contemporary reviewer remarked somewhat sarcastically, “Unfortunately thick smoke escaping from the canvas prevented our seeing the six ...

WebThe Duke Of Normandy was one of the first locomotives to pull a train in Jersey. The date is given as 29 th September 1870. This was before the seawall had been strengthened along St Aubin's Bay, and the track was vulnerable to storms. The following is a newspaper article of the time: The Jersey Railway Company Limited.
